Increase the heat regulating current
Reduce the voltage drop across the internal MOSFET can
significantly reduce the power consump�on of the IC.
During thermal regula�on, this has an increased current
supplied to the ba�ery. One strategy is accomplished by an
external element (e.g., a resistor or a diode) will be part of
the power consump�on.
Example: FC9056 is powered by a 5v AC adapter, it charge to
one with a 3.75V voltage lithium-ion ba�ery, and set the
full-scale charge current 800mA by programming. Assuming
θJA is 125 ℃/W, at 25 ℃ ambient temperature condi�ons,
the charging current is approximately:

Take RCC=0.25Ω , VS=5V , VBAT=3.75V , TA=25℃ , and
θJA=125℃/W,we can calculate the heat adjustment charge
current: IBAT = 948mA. The results shows that the structure
can be full scale output 800mA charging current at higher
ambient temperatures.
Although this applica�on can deliver more energy to the
ba�ery in heat regula�ng mode and shorten the charging
�me, But in voltage mode, if VCC becomes low enough
leaving FC9056 state at low voltage drop, It is actually
possible to extend the charging �me. Figure 4 shows how
the circuit becomes large as the RCC resul�ng voltage drop.
When in order to maintain a smaller component size and to
avoid voltage drop leaving the RCC values minimized, this
technology can play a role in the best. Keep in mind: you
should select a sufficient power handling capability resistor.

Automatic restart
Once the charge cycle is terminated, FC9056 immediately
adopt a comparator with 1.8ms filter �me con�nuously
monitor the BAT pin voltage. When the ba�ery voltage
drops below 4.05V or less (Generally corresponding to the
ba�ery capacity from 80 to 90%), charging cycle restart.
This ensures that the battery is maintained at (or near) a
full charge state, and eliminates the periodic need to
